当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器虚拟化的实现方式有哪些,深入解析服务器虚拟化实现方式,技术原理与应用场景

服务器虚拟化的实现方式有哪些,深入解析服务器虚拟化实现方式,技术原理与应用场景

服务器虚拟化实现方式包括硬件虚拟化、操作系统虚拟化和应用虚拟化。硬件虚拟化利用CPU虚拟化技术实现,操作系统虚拟化通过虚拟机管理程序实现,应用虚拟化则独立于操作系统。技...

服务器虚拟化实现方式包括硬件虚拟化、操作系统虚拟化和应用虚拟化。硬件虚拟化利用CPU虚拟化技术实现,操作系统虚拟化通过虚拟机管理程序实现,应用虚拟化则独立于操作系统。技术原理涉及CPU指令集模拟、内存管理、设备驱动等。应用场景涵盖数据中心、云计算、桌面虚拟化等。

随着云计算、大数据等技术的飞速发展,服务器虚拟化技术已成为现代IT基础设施的重要组成部分,服务器虚拟化可以将一台物理服务器划分为多个虚拟机(VM),实现资源的高效利用和灵活配置,本文将深入解析服务器虚拟化的实现方式,包括其技术原理、主要类型、应用场景以及发展趋势。

服务器虚拟化的技术原理

服务器虚拟化技术主要基于以下原理:

1、虚拟化层:虚拟化层是服务器虚拟化的核心,负责将物理服务器资源(如CPU、内存、硬盘等)抽象成虚拟资源,并分配给各个虚拟机。

2、虚拟机:虚拟机是服务器虚拟化的基本单元,它具有独立的操作系统、应用程序和资源,虚拟机之间相互隔离,互不影响。

服务器虚拟化的实现方式有哪些,深入解析服务器虚拟化实现方式,技术原理与应用场景

3、虚拟化软件:虚拟化软件是服务器虚拟化的实现工具,负责管理虚拟机、分配资源、实现虚拟化功能等。

4、虚拟化硬件:虚拟化硬件是指支持虚拟化的物理服务器,如支持虚拟化技术的CPU、内存、硬盘等。

服务器虚拟化的主要类型

1、全虚拟化:全虚拟化技术可以将物理服务器完全虚拟化,为每个虚拟机提供一个完整的硬件虚拟化环境,主要代表技术有VMware ESXi、Xen等。

2、超虚拟化:超虚拟化技术允许虚拟机直接访问物理服务器的部分硬件资源,从而提高虚拟机的性能,主要代表技术有Microsoft Hyper-V、KVM等。

3、裸机虚拟化:裸机虚拟化技术将物理服务器的操作系统与硬件资源隔离开来,虚拟机可以直接运行在硬件上,主要代表技术有VMware vSphere、Citrix XenServer等。

服务器虚拟化的实现方式有哪些,深入解析服务器虚拟化实现方式,技术原理与应用场景

服务器虚拟化的应用场景

1、云计算平台:服务器虚拟化技术是实现云计算平台的基础,可以提高资源利用率、降低运维成本,满足大规模、高并发的业务需求。

2、数据中心虚拟化:通过服务器虚拟化技术,可以将数据中心内的物理服务器资源进行整合,实现资源的高效利用和灵活配置。

3、应用部署与迁移:服务器虚拟化技术可以简化应用部署和迁移过程,提高IT运维效率。

4、灾难恢复:通过虚拟化技术,可以实现数据中心的快速恢复,提高业务连续性。

服务器虚拟化的发展趋势

1、软硬件一体化:随着虚拟化技术的发展,虚拟化硬件将逐渐融入物理服务器,实现更高效的虚拟化性能。

服务器虚拟化的实现方式有哪些,深入解析服务器虚拟化实现方式,技术原理与应用场景

2、开源虚拟化:开源虚拟化技术将越来越受到关注,如KVM、OpenStack等。

3、虚拟化与容器技术融合:虚拟化技术与容器技术将实现融合,为用户提供更灵活、高效的资源调度和管理。

4、智能化虚拟化:随着人工智能技术的发展,虚拟化技术将实现智能化,提高资源利用率、降低运维成本。

服务器虚拟化技术作为一种高效、灵活的IT基础设施,已在云计算、数据中心等领域得到广泛应用,随着虚拟化技术的不断发展,其在未来将发挥更加重要的作用,本文深入解析了服务器虚拟化的实现方式,包括技术原理、主要类型、应用场景以及发展趋势,旨在为广大读者提供有益的参考。

黑狐家游戏

发表评论

最新文章